"I can't breathe": A case study-Helping Black men cope with race-related trauma stemming from police killing and brutality
It is impossible for individuals to survive without the ability to breathe. Eric Garner, an unarmed Black man, uttered "I can't breathe" during an arrest by the police, who placed him a chokehold and caused his death (Goldstein & Schweber, 2014). Seeing this inhuman image on video...
